Overview

Oddero "Brunate" Barolo DOCG 2018 is an elegant and refined wine from one of the most prestigious crus in the Barolo region, the Brunate vineyard. Known for producing wines with depth, complexity, and long aging potential, Brunate provides an exceptional terroir for Nebbiolo. The 2018 vintage showcases the classic characteristics of Barolo—rich fruit, floral notes, and a vibrant structure—while maintaining a sense of balance and accessibility. This wine reflects the careful craftsmanship of the Oddero family, who have a long tradition of producing wines with precision and longevity.

Vinification and Aging

  • Fermentation: The Nebbiolo grapes were hand-harvested and fermented in temperature-controlled stainless steel tanks, ensuring the preservation of fresh fruit flavors and a controlled extraction of tannins.
  • Aging: After fermentation, the wine was aged for 24 months in large Slavonian oak barrels, allowing for a gentle integration of oak and the retention of the wine's natural fruit character. The wine was then further aged in bottle for an additional 12 months before being released to market.
  • Bottling: The wine was bottled without fining or filtration, maintaining the wine's natural expression and allowing it to evolve gracefully in the bottle.

Tasting Notes

  • Appearance: The wine has a vibrant ruby-red color, transitioning to garnet at the rim as it ages.
  • Aroma: The nose is complex and multifaceted, with aromas of red cherries, rose petals, and dried herbs. As it opens, additional notes of leather, tobacco, and earthiness emerge, complemented by hints of spices like cinnamon and clove.
  • Palate: On the palate, the wine is full-bodied with a firm tannic structure, characteristic of a young Barolo. It has a bright acidity that provides freshness and balance. The flavors are rich and layered, with notes of ripe red fruit, licorice, and a hint of smoke. The finish is long and persistent, with a delicate minerality and lingering hints of dried herbs.

Food Pairing

This wine pairs wonderfully with classic Barolo dishes such as braised beef, roast lamb, or wild game. It is also excellent with truffle-based dishes, hearty stews, and aged cheeses such as Pecorino or aged Manchego.

Serving Recommendations

  • Serving Temperature: Best served at 18°C (64°F) to fully appreciate its aromas and structure.
  • Decanting: Decanting is recommended, especially if drinking young, to help soften the tannins and allow the wine to open up.

Aging Potential

The Oddero "Brunate" Barolo DOCG 2018 has significant aging potential, with a drinking window from 2025 to 2045 and beyond. The wine's structure and acidity will allow it to evolve and develop further complexity with time.
